Understanding Driving License Costs: A Comprehensive Breakdown
Obtaining a driving license is an essential rite of passage for numerous people. It represents not only the capability to operate a lorry lawfully however likewise a newly found liberty and responsibility. However, the costs connected with obtaining a driving license can vary substantially depending upon numerous factors, including geographical place, age, type of license, and extra services required. This post intends to supply an extensive analysis of driving license expenses, clarifying what costs people might expect throughout the process.
Components of Driving License Costs
The total cost of protecting a driving license can be broken down into a number of parts, including:
Application Fees: A fee required when sending the application for a driving license.Student's Permit (if appropriate): If individuals are new motorists, they might require to get a student's license before getting a complete license.Driver Education Courses: Many states need brand-new chauffeurs to finish a motorist education course, which can sustain additional expenses.Checking Fees: Fees related to taking the written, vision, or driving tests.License Issuance Fee: The cost for the real driving license once all tests are successfully completed.Renewal Fees: Costs for renewing the driving license after it expires.Extra Services: Costs might occur from other required services, such as vision tests or documents processing.

Driving license expenses can vary considerably due to a number of factors:
1. State or Country Regulations
Various states and countries have varying policies surrounding driving education and licensing. For example, some areas might require extensive motorist education programs, while others may not have any prerequisite at all.
2. Age and Experience
More youthful chauffeurs or new chauffeurs are often needed to undertake more classes or training, causing higher initial expenses. In contrast, experienced chauffeurs may deal with fewer requirements and therefore incur lower expenses.
3. Type of License
The type of driving license being gotten (e.g., standard, commercial, motorcycle) will likewise influence expenses. Industrial licenses frequently require additional training and testing, which can get costly.
4. Extra Testing and Services
If additional services such as vision tests or online classes are required, the general cost of acquiring a driving license will increase.
Frequently Asked Questions About Driving License Costs1. What is the average cost of acquiring a driving license?
The average cost to acquire a basic driving license can range from ₤ 40 to ₤ 400, depending upon numerous factors such as place, age, and additional services.
2. Are there any hidden charges I should understand?
In addition to the basic costs, candidates must be mindful of prospective hidden costs, such as costs for retesting if one stops working the composed or driving exam, or extra expenses for required paperwork.
3. Do I need to take a chauffeur education course?
While it is compulsory in many states for teens, adults may not be needed to take a driver education course. Nevertheless, completing one might help in passing the tests more quickly and might lower insurance premiums in the future.
4. Can I spend for my driving license application online?
The majority of states permit online applications and payments for driving licenses. However, candidates must examine their local DMV or transport department's site for particular information.
5. How often do I need to renew my driving license?
Renewal periods vary by state however commonly range from 4 to eight years. Contact your regional Department of Motor Vehicles (DMV) for the specific timeframe.
